GHG Accounting and Climate Reporting in Sacramento
Ecos environmental Sacramento supports organizations in building robust greenhouse gas inventories aligned with recognized protocols. Clear emissions data underpins credible climate targets, investor communication, and regulatory compliance.
By combining activity data, emission factors, and system boundaries tailored to local operations, the team produces defensible inventories that highlight major sources and reduction opportunities. These insights feed directly into scenario modeling and action planning.
Energy Efficiency and Renewable Integration
Local facilities and operations across Sacramento face rising energy costs and grid constraints, making efficiency a priority. Ecos environmental Sacramento conducts detailed assessments and designs measures that deliver measurable savings.
From lighting and controls to HVAC upgrades and on site renewables, solutions are tailored to site specific constraints and financing options. Project performance is tracked to validate expected energy, cost, and carbon benefits.
Water Resilience and Watershed Management
Sacramento’s water systems must balance flood protection, environmental flows, and growing demand. Ecos environmental Sacramento helps organizations understand exposure and implement practical conservation measures.
Programs include risk mapping, metering, leak detection, and irrigation optimization, all aligned with regional water supply planning. These actions reduce nonrevenue water and strengthen drought preparedness.
Waste Reduction and Circularity Strategies
Effective waste management reduces operating expenses while supporting circular economy objectives. The team reviews material streams and identifies high value recovery pathways.
Initiatives may include procurement changes, on site sorting, and partnerships with local recyclers and processors. Tracking key metrics ensures continuous improvement and compliance with evolving regulations.

How do you measure return on investment for water and energy projects?
Ecos environmental Sacramento combines baseline modeling with post implementation monitoring, applying agreed KPIs, weather normalization, and verified savings to demonstrate payback, net present value, and incentive capture.
